随着互联网技术的飞速发展,网络安全问题日益凸显。在众多网络安全威胁中,语音通话的安全性成为了人们关注的焦点。为了确保语音通话的安全,各大厂商纷纷推出了语音通话SDK,并引入了语音加密技术。本文将深入探讨语音通话SDK的语音加密技术,分析其原理、应用场景以及未来发展。

一、语音加密技术原理

1.对称加密算法

对称加密算法是一种加密和解密使用相同密钥的加密方式。在语音通话SDK中,常用的对称加密算法有AES(高级加密标准)、3DES(三重数据加密算法)等。对称加密算法具有加密速度快、安全性高等优点。

2.非对称加密算法

非对称加密算法是一种加密和解密使用不同密钥的加密方式。在语音通话SDK中,常用的非对称加密算法有RSA(公钥加密算法)、ECC(椭圆曲线加密算法)等。非对称加密算法在保证通信安全的同时,还能实现密钥的交换。

3.混合加密算法

混合加密算法是将对称加密算法和非对称加密算法相结合的加密方式。在语音通话SDK中,常用的混合加密算法有TLS(传输层安全协议)、SIP(会话初始化协议)等。混合加密算法既保证了加密速度,又提高了安全性。

二、语音加密技术应用场景

1.个人隐私保护

在语音通话过程中,用户可能会涉及个人隐私信息,如家庭住址、电话号码等。通过引入语音加密技术,可以有效防止隐私泄露。

2.企业通信安全

企业内部通信涉及大量商业机密,通过语音通话SDK的语音加密技术,可以确保企业通信安全,防止信息泄露。

3.政府通信安全

政府部门的通信涉及国家安全和社会稳定,语音通话SDK的语音加密技术可以有效保障政府通信安全。

4.跨境通信安全

跨境通信涉及不同国家和地区的法律法规,语音通话SDK的语音加密技术可以满足不同国家和地区的通信安全需求。

三、语音加密技术未来发展

1.算法优化

随着加密算法研究的不断深入,未来的语音加密技术将更加注重算法的优化,提高加密速度和安全性。

2.跨平台兼容性

随着移动设备的多样化,语音通话SDK的语音加密技术需要具备跨平台兼容性,以满足不同用户的通信需求。

3.人工智能辅助

人工智能技术在语音加密领域的应用将不断深入,通过人工智能技术可以实现对语音加密过程的自动化和智能化,提高语音通话的安全性。

4.量子加密技术

量子加密技术具有极高的安全性,未来有望应用于语音通话SDK的语音加密技术,为用户提供更加安全的通信保障。

总之,语音通话SDK的语音加密技术在确保通信安全方面具有重要意义。随着技术的不断发展,语音加密技术将更加完善,为用户提供更加安全、便捷的通信服务。